Good Morning Britain presenter Ed Balls has sparked uproar following an on-air exchange with an antisemitism campaigner in the aftermath of an arson attack on a Jewish volunteer ambulance service. This backlash followed a moment during the broadcast when Balls asked campaigner Dov Forman if Shadow Justice Secretary Nick Timothy’s criticism of the Trafalgar Square Iftar event last week is “causing problems” for the Jewish community. Elaborating further, the former Labour politician highlighted comments regarding Muslim prayer at the event, questioning if such rhetoric threatened to fracture the Jewish community.
